ZPOOL-ATTACH(8)         FreeBSD System Manager's Manual        ZPOOL-ATTACH(8)

NAME
     zpool-attach - attach new device to existing ZFS vdev

SYNOPSIS
     zpool attach [-fsw] [-o property=value] pool device new_device

DESCRIPTION
     Attaches new_device to the existing device.  The existing device cannot
     be part of a raidz configuration.  If device is not currently part of a
     mirrored configuration, device automatically transforms into a two-way
     mirror of device and new_device.  If device is part of a two-way mirror,
     attaching new_device creates a three-way mirror, and so on.  In either
     case, new_device begins to resilver immediately and any running scrub is
     cancelled.

     -f      Forces use of new_device, even if it appears to be in use.  Not
             all devices can be overridden in this manner.

     -o property=value
             Sets the given pool properties.  See the zpoolprops(7) manual
             page for a list of valid properties that can be set.  The only
             property supported at the moment is ashift.

     -s      The new_device is reconstructed sequentially to restore
             redundancy as quickly as possible.  Checksums are not verified
             during sequential reconstruction so a scrub is started when the
             resilver completes.  Sequential reconstruction is not supported
             for raidz configurations.

     -w      Waits until new_device has finished resilvering before returning.
